June Rankings Movement (Froch, Geale, Chavez)

A lot of new names crack the SNB June rankings.  With some great showings from young fighters, the "Bubbling Under List" swells with three first-time entrants.  Also, a rugged veteran turned in a great performance leading to his debut on the rankings list.

Elevated: Carl Froch  With Carl Froch's solid victory over Glen Johnson, he cements his status as one of the three best super middleweights in the world, along with Andre Ward and Lucian Bute.  He lands on the "Fighters on the Cusp" list.  The winner of Ward-Froch will join the SNB Elite Fighters list.

Elevated: Daniel Geale  Upon further reflection, Geale's title-winning victory in Germany over Sebastian Sylvester deserves special consideration.  As the Sturm-Macklin decision further demonstrates, it's not easy to win a decision on the road in Germany.  Geale brings new life into the middleweight division.  Right now, he is on the "Bubbling Under" list.  With a few more victories like the Sylvester one, he can see his stature in the sport rise dramatically.

Elevated: Julio Cesar Chavez, Jr.  True, Chavez is far from an elite fighter, but his entertaining victory over Sebastian Zbik showed that Junior has a fighter's mentality.   He also has a significant fan base, drawing excellent television ratings and selling tickets both in Mexico and in the western United States.  He debuts on the Bubbling Under list.  

Elevated:  Mikey Garcia  Garcia's destruction of Rafael Guzman informed the boxing world that he is ready to take on all comers at featherweight.  Garcia possesses knockout power, solid defensive technique, a cerebral approach to aggression and exemplary counter punching skills.  He makes the SNB Bubbling Under list.

Demoted:  Denis Boytsov  Heavyweight Boytsov has not fought in seven months and has suffered a serious hand injury that has pushed back his return to the ring.  The momentum of his career has stalled.  He leaves the Bubbling Under list.
